The Los Angeles Lakers announce they have waived Chris Duhon. According to Lakers beat writer Mike Bresnahan, Duhon's buyout was $1.5 million.

As early as late April, the Los Angeles Times was reporting that Duhon would not return for another season with the team. From the report:

Chris Duhon is on the books for $3.75 million next season but can be bought out for about one-third that amount. He won't be back.

In his 46 games with the Lakers, Duhon had nine starts, averaged 2.9 points, 1.5 rebounds and 2.9 assists with 17.8 minutes. He had three double-scoring games.

General manager Mitch Kupchak made the announcement that Duhon had been waived.
